Celje

Located in the heart of Slovenia, Celje is a charming city in the Savinja region, a perfect destination for those seeking a blend of history and nature. Known as the "City of Counts," Celje boasts a rich and diverse heritage that dates back to the Roman era. Walking through its streets, visitors can encounter picturesque medieval buildings and uncover intriguing stories at the Celje Regional Museum, which houses important archaeological finds.

One of the main landmarks is Celje Castle, one of the largest and most impressive castles in Slovenia, built by the Counts of Celje in the 14th century. The view from the castle tower is unparalleled, offering breathtaking panoramas of the city and the surrounding hills. During the summer, the castle hosts historical festivals, concerts, and theatrical performances, making the visit an unforgettable experience for all ages.
